Genius School

There's a joke between my co-workers about children.  It started with my boss & wasn't shared with me until after I had Alex.  Basically my boss tells the story of having their first child & being amazed at everything she did.  He says his daughter would do something they thought was just remarkable & they'd look at each other & say - "genius school!" because they just knew she was immensely smart & talented.  Of course, as she got older & they had a few more children, he realized that she was a normal kid with strengths & weaknesses.  His story speaks to that feeling all first time parents have - you may not even realize you're doing it but you can't help but think your kid is AMAZING.

I learned about this phenomenon when one day my boss & I were on our way to visit a client.  He asked how Alex was doing & I told him how he was rolling over already & I couldn't believe it.  Later, he said to my co-worker - "Did Stephanie tell you about Alex?"  I launched into my story about how Alex was rolling over, blah blah blah & my boss said - "He's definitely going to genius school."  That's when my co-worker explained the genius school joke.  My boss had told him about it when he had his first child a few years ago (of course, he pointed out that his son really WAS going to genius school - ha!)  It's something that doesn't really make sense before you have kids but I totally get it now.

I told Michael about it & ever since then, we joke about it with each other.
